Olde worlde pub serving traditional British meals with daily changing specials. No TV or music, just lively conversation. This beautifully preserved, Grade II listed Victorian pub still has the etched glass snob screens in place above the bar.
These frosted glass snob screens were popular in the 1890s and hid the customer from the publican when they ordered their drinks, but the hinges still allowed the the bar staff to check on the customers without disturbing their privacy.
